All the broadcasters pooh pooh's Russell Wilson's abilities, until contract talks come along. Then the truth comes out that "Hey, Russell Wilson is an ELITE QB!" And a pocket passer! Who can play well without Marshawn Lynch and the #1 Defense! Go figure.

But now they're forced to admit the truth, else every other NFL article wouldn't be about RW's upcoming contract, and they wouldn't be saying this:

The highest-rated passer in NFL history (103.1 career passer rating) is also, fittingly, the highest-paid player in NFL history ... for now. Seahawks star Russell Wilson is entering the final season of his current contract, meaning the baton for QB contracts should be passed along soon. Rodgers received $66.9 million in the first year of an extension that included the largest signing bonus in NFL history ($57.5 million).
